| Quotations and Estimates All quotations and estimates provided by Altitude IT for software development are valid for a period of 30 days from date of issue. Quotations not accepted within this timeframe must be re‐issued. All quotations are required to be accepted using the supplied Quotation Acceptance Form and returned to Altitude IT within the 30 day period from date of issuance. Estimates may be provided by Altitude IT to offer the client a guide on the projected costing of a project prior to any discovery or research for said project. All estimates will be clearly marked as such and are not an indication of the exact final cost to develop the application. All estimates will need to be formalized to a quotation or invoice before acceptance by either party as the final cost of the application. Payment Terms All quotations provided by Altitude IT, require a 50% deposit upon acceptance. Unless prior arrangement has been made, final payment is strictly net 7 days from the date of completion. Any cost arising from payment clearings or transaction charges are solely the responsibility of the client and will be charged as such. Altitude IT will only commence work on the quoted application once any deposited funds have cleared. Residency Requirements Minimum requirements for where the completed application will reside, will be provided on all Altitude IT quotations. The quoted cost on an Altitude IT quotation is only valid if the minimum residency requirements are met or exceeded for said quotation. Altitude IT can provide, as an additional service, a package that will meet the stated requirements. The package offered will provide the most streamlined and cost‐effective installation of the quoted application. If an Altitude IT package is not used to host the completed application, Altitude IT will not be liable for any additional time or resources, above and beyond that already included in the quotation, required to get the completed application installed where the client has asked it to reside. Altitude IT will bill any additional time and or resources, above and beyond that already included in the quotation, required to get the completed application installed on the clients host at $120 per hour. Intellectual Property Unless specified all quotations provided by Altitude IT, do not include any source code license. All source code and associated intellectual property relating to said source code, developed by Altitude IT, solely remains the property of Altitude IT, except where specific code license has been issued to the client and said issuance has been indicated in writing from Altitude IT. Any alteration, reverse engineering, or manipulation of any kind on the code, compiled or otherwise, created by Altitude IT for the quoted application may be a breach of trademark and copyright laws. If said breach is confirmed, penalties will apply under the relevant acts. Any costs incurred by Altitude IT for third party code license required to complete the quoted application are the responsibility of the client and will be solely borne by the client. Any such third party code license will be attached to the existing Altitude IT code license for the quoted application. Cancellations Should the client wish to cancel acceptance of the quotation, Altitude IT will invoice the client for any work completed to date, as a percentage of the total work involved.
Content Clients are required to ensure that the content of the application being quoted adheres to all the current Australian legislation regarding publication. The client shall further indemnify Altitude IT in respect of any claims, costs and expenses that may arise from any material included within the quoted application by Altitude IT at the client’s request. Altitude IT reserves the right not to include any material supplied by the client within the quoted application if Altitude IT deems said material inappropriate or offensive. Altitude IT will not populate the application with the final content unless said content is delivered to Altitude IT in digital format prior to commencement of work. Said content, if available, will be used for testing purposes and may not be formatted how the client requires it. If content is not available mock placeholder content will be used. Permissions and Copyrights The client will obtain all necessary permissions and authorities with respect to the use of all copy, graphics, logos, names and trademarks and any other material supplied by the client to Altitude IT. Supply of said material by the client to Altitude IT shall be regarded as a guarantee from the client that all such permissions and authorities have been sought and obtained for said material. No responsibility will be accepted by Altitude IT for damages or losses incurred by the client from the use of material for which permission or authority has not been obtained. Errors and Liabilities Altitude IT will pursue due care to ensure applications create by Altitude IT are free of errors. Altitude IT will correct any errors made by Altitude IT staff in the undertaking of the quoted application before the application has been signed off as completed. Altitude IT does not accept responsibility for losses or damage arising from errors within any application. Altitude IT does not accept responsibility for errors, damages, losses or additional costs that relate to third party products that Altitude IT may require completing the quoted application. Alterations Any alterations requested by the client after development has begun will incur extra development and regression testing time. Dependent upon the alteration or change requested an average of 1 day extra development time per alteration should be allowed for. The 1 day average may not be indicative of the time required and can be extended commensurate of the time involved to implement said changes. Altitude IT will not accept responsibility for any alterations performed by the client or any third party which may cause or induce errors within the quoted application. If Altitude IT are required to correct said alterations or errors resulting from said alterations, induced, injected or otherwise caused by parties other than Altitude IT, the client will be charged at the hourly rate that is current for Altitude IT at the time said errors are to be fixed. Completion of Work All timeframes offered by Altitude IT to the client are estimates. The intrinsic nature of software development and its intricacies do not offer Altitude IT the luxury of defining definite timeframes. Altitude IT will endeavour to complete all work within the estimated timeframes discussed with the client in the quotation. However, Altitude IT will not be liable for any penalties, monies or hardships otherwise incurred by the client if the application cannot be delivered within the estimated timeframe. Altitude IT will not release the quoted application unless all payments have been met under the obligations of the quotation or work agreement. If Altitude IT does not have control over the residence (see Residency Requirements) where the finished work will reside then full payment must be made prior to said work being released by Altitude IT. The quoted application remains the property of Altitude IT Software until all obligations have been met for release of said application to the client. If Altitude IT is working as a third party to another company, said company is responsible in meeting the obligations for release of the quote application to their client. The final product delivered will be referenced back to the original project scope documentation in any case where the client feels the final product does not meet their requested requirements, this document will act as the guide to confirm that the original requests have been met.
